About me

My career in UX began when I was the Editor of PC Magazine. As part of our service to readers we built the world's first magazine usability lab to test and evaluate software. It was these kinds of innovations which led the magazine to be awarded PPC Magazine of the Year. I was later recognised as a columnist of the year in the PMA awards.

PC Magazine recognised the value of the Internet early (awarding Demon Internet an award when few had even heard of the term) and PCMagazine was one of the first few hundred sites in the world even beating it's US parent to the web. I later moved on to managing the web sites which included a number of high traffic sites including Gamespot.

Once leaving publishing I became a web consultation and have been a Senior UX Designer and Researcher for nearly 20 years. As you will see from my CV, I have worked for a wide range of organisations both and small and have learnt how to quickly adapt to the company culture and development style.

My approach to UX is firmly rooted in Design Thinking. Beginning with gaining a firm understanding of the domain, the user, their goals and challenges I create a series of designs based on this research which I share with stakeholders and users until a final design is agreed.

I work closely with the development team to ensure they understand the user stories and my solutions. Finally, on launch I will then interview or shadow users to assess their acceptance and create a feedback report which will form the basis of further iterations of the site.
